Establishment
- January 1158: When Sultan Ahmad Sanjar died in 1157, the atabegs (governos) of the Seljuk Empire became effectively independent.

1. Mongol invasions and conquests
Were a series of military campaigny by the Mongols that created the largest contiguous Empire in history, the Mongol Empire, which controlled most of Eurasia.
- January 1263: During the closing years of Aku Bakr and Sa'd II, Fars fell under the dominion of Mongol empire and later the Ilkhanate of Hulegu.
2. Further events (Unrelated to Any War)
- January 1205: Isfahan conquered by Salghurids.
- January 1236: The Salghurids occupied Bahrain which was taken from the Uyunid dynasty in 1235.
Disestablishment
- January 1283: Following the extinction of the Salghurids, Fars was ruled directly by the Ilkhanate.
